I am a long time software engineer who decided to do 4 years in the Navy to help out while I was still young enough. Anyway, somehow my moto droid crapped out and now it won't boot -- it shows the initial M logo and then the screen blanks and then the M logo comes back, over and over.
So here I figured, "hey, I'm a techie, I'll just reinstall the OS, no problem!". Boy was I wrong. I've been going nuts trying to get my phone to connect to the PC. First, let me say, the only two stable modes I can boot into are bootloader and recovery. Also, I'm using WinXP.
First I went to the moto site and tried to get it to restore the OS. Drivers install fine but the web app won't see my phone -- in bootloader it says it's not getting a device ID and in recovery it says the phone isn't in USB mode.
Ok, so then I tried using the SDK. Well, the drivers won't install. So I wiped the moto drivers. When I put the phone in bootloader mode and plug it in, it says it found an "SE Flash" device. When I direct it to the SDK drivers, it says it can't find any drivers for the device. When I try it in recovery mode, it finds a "Motorola A55 USB Device" and I can't update the drivers to the SDK ones either. Heck, even with the A55 drivers, I can't access the "Removable Disk" from Explorer.
Anyway, I'm stuck and I really need this phone to work since being in the military means I have to be reachable at all times. I'd really appreciate any help you can give me. Ultimately I just need to get the OS back in regardless of how -- maybe I've been going about it wrong?
